THE CRY OF BALINTOCATOK. There’s of course the historical Cry of Balintawak where brave nationalists led by Andres Bonifacio tore their cedulas to declare the start of the revolution against Spain. This is the Cry of Balitocatok, named after a village in Santiago, Isabela where they grow a revolutionary kind of Watermelon. It’s the Diana, a beautiful contradiction of smooth golden yellow skin and crunchy, red inside flesh of such exceeding sweetness that you would cry.
